The numbering works similarly to a netdevice's ifindex, with > > identifiers that are only recycled once INT_MAX has been reached. > > > > This prevents races that could occur between PHY listing and SFP > > transceiver removal/insertion. > > > > The identifiers are assigned at phy_attach time, as the numbering > > depends on the netdevice the phy is attached to. > > I think you can simplify this code quite a bit by using idr. > idr_alloc_cyclic() looks like it will do the allocation you want, > plus the IDR subsystem will store the pointer to the object (in > this case the phy device) and allow you to look that up. That > probably gets rid of quite a bit of code. > > You will need to handle the locking around IDR however. Oh thanks for pointing this out. I had considered idr but I didn't spot the _cyclic() helper, and I had ruled that out thinking it would re-use ids directly after freeing them. I'll be more than happy to use that. Thanks, Maxime
